What is a major disadvantage of using a high-pressure sprayer?

Using a high-pressure sprayer typically leads to an increased risk of overspray because the force at which the solution is expelled can create a wider spray pattern. This means that while the equipment can effectively reach tall or distant areas, it can also unintentionally apply pesticide or other chemicals to areas that are not intended for treatment, potentially affecting non-target plants, animals, or water sources nearby.

The nature of high pressure can make it challenging to control the precise landing of the sprayed material, contributing to drift and overspray. Therefore, applicators must be mindful of environmental factors, such as wind, that can exacerbate this issue, as well as adjust their techniques to minimize the risk of overspray when using high-pressure systems.
